Elebase is a back end as a service with geospatial capabilities.

Elebase's fully managed platform provides a powerful API and a rich set of tools to help you build more elegant applications faster and more efficiently. Spend more time building custom features that solve customer problems, and less time designing and maintaining back-end systems.

    Scalr is a tool that was created to give the Terraform community an affordable alternative to Terraform Cloud/Enterprise. Scalr is the only product in the space that has a hierarchical model to allow for object inheritance/sharing from a top-down perspective, cross-environment/workspace visibility, and custom RBAC to accommodate any complex org standards. Scalr can operate in a centralized or decentralized way... Source: over 2 years ago
